Killer Whales Have Secret Clubs Did you know that West Coast killer whales are divided into two secret clubs? That’s right! Scientists discovered that one group of orcas loves to hang out in the inner coast, navigating through twisty waterways to hunt for smaller snacks. Meanwhile, the other group prefers the deep sea, where they chase after bigger marine animals. Even though these orcas live in the same ocean, they rarely bump into each other. It’s like they have their own secret hideouts! This discovery makes us wonder what other secrets ocean animals might be keeping from us. What do you think is out there?
Colossal Structures Deep Within Earth In another exciting discovery, scientists have uncovered gigantic structures located nearly 1,800 miles beneath the Earth's surface! These immense formations could help us understand how life began on our planet. Researchers from Rutgers University believe that by studying these structures, they can learn ancient secrets about Earth’s core and mantle. They suggest that certain elements from the core may have seeped into the mantle, making Earth a perfect home for life. What other mysteries do you think are hidden deep within our planet?
The Importance of Microscopic Organisms Have you ever thought about the tiniest living things on Earth? Scientists say that preserving microscopic organisms is one of the most important conservation efforts ever! These tiny life forms play a crucial role in keeping our environment balanced. They help with everything from digesting food to cleaning our air and water. Without them, the consequences could be disastrous for all living beings, including us! Mini Blood Factory Created by Scientists In a groundbreaking development, scientists have created a tiny human "blood factory" that works effectively! Picture a lab smaller than a coin, where human blood can be produced. This amazing invention could be a game-changer for people who need blood for surgeries or medical treatments. Imagine a future where doctors can request blood just like they would order a special product from a lab. This innovation could make blood supplies safer and more accessible for hospitals everywhere!
The Benefits of Vitamin D Have you heard of the sunshine vitamin? Scientists have found that vitamin D does much more than just strengthen our bones! It’s also important for keeping our immune system strong and our hearts healthy. As winter approaches and sunlight becomes scarce, some people may need to think about taking vitamin D supplements, especially in places where the sun doesn’t shine much. Who knew a simple vitamin could have such big benefits?
Moss Grows in Space Lastly, scientists placed moss outside the International Space Station for nine months, and guess what? It continued to grow! This amazing discovery shows that plants can survive the extreme conditions of space. This breakthrough could help astronauts grow their own food during long missions or even on other planets.
